Flat Roof Installation Cost Estimates in Worcester, MA
Typical price ranges for flat roof installation projects in Worcester, MA, generally fall between $4,000 - $10,000 for standard-sized structures. Larger or more complex projects may exceed this range.
For smaller or simpler installations, costs may be closer to $3,500 - $5,500.
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Flat Roof | $4,000 - $6,000 |
| Re-roofing / Overlay | $3,500 - $5,500 |
| Built-up Roofing (BUR) | $5,000 - $10,000 |
| Modified Bitumen | $4,500 - $8,000 |
| Single-Ply Membrane (EPDM, TPO, PVC) | $4,500 - $9,000 |
| Insulation Replacement | $3,500 - $7,000 |
| Complex or Custom Installations | $8,000 - $15,000 |
What affects the cost of flat roof installation
Understanding the factors that influence flat roof installation costs can help in planning and comparing options in Worcester, MA. The following elements typically impact the overall project expenses:
- Materials used: Different roofing materials, such as EPDM, TPO, or modified bitumen, vary in cost and durability, affecting the total price.
- Size and scope: Larger roofs or those with complex layouts generally require more materials and labor, increasing costs.
- Labor complexity: Roofs with features like multiple levels, penetrations, or difficult access can require additional labor and specialized skills.
- Permitting requirements: Local Worcester regulations may necessitate permits that add to the overall project expenses.
- Additional features or upgrades: Items such as insulation, drainage systems, or protective coatings can influence the final cost.
